Repurposed pallets

A great way to recycle shipping pallets is to use old pallets as shelves. Pallets come in many different sizes and shapes, are easy to use, and are very affordable. These versatile furniture pieces can be used to add style and function in a space. Listed below are some examples of ways to use pallets for a shelf. Remember, these shelves can be painted to any color that you choose. This allows you to change the appearance of your room.

Brackets

Before you start assembling your shelf make sure that you measure the distance between two wall studs. In order to hang heavy items like shelves, studs are the best places to attach brackets. You can use an electronic "studfinder" to locate them or tap the wall lightly using a hammer. It is possible that electrical wiring exists in the wall. This information must be taken into consideration before you start.

Repurposed wash basins

Use repurposed basins to make storage shelves. These rustic basins were once used to wash your hands. But they can now be used as shelves for cleaning products, soaps, and towels. These shelves can be made by you following the instructions provided by BarwoodShop. For extra storage, hang the wash basins on planks once they are assembled.
